Transaction 3a90fcd44c30c984838ae60d25b803ab3ee182d12836e5dc66f9a9e6faf006c4

1 Input
2 Outputs
  • 3a90fcd44c30c984838ae60d25b803ab3ee182d12836e5dc66f9a9e6faf006c4:0
  • value  1019760
    address  1MG2FAoPT77WgWWtsQx1TihBcZ8iFa6tzs
  • 3a90fcd44c30c984838ae60d25b803ab3ee182d12836e5dc66f9a9e6faf006c4:1
  • value  7599920
    address  1N4mLUjTySKHhmnGHRJrxRGNTeiS3RLpwz